Little Kimble Train Station may be small, but it offers essential conveniences for passengers. While there is no ticket office, ticket machines available help travelers collect pre-booked tickets with ease. However, it’s important to note that these machines are not accessible for all individuals, possibly necessitating preplanning for those with mobility challenges. The station features step-free access across its platform, aligning with its commitment to accessibility, but lacks dedicated ramp access to trains or accessible toilets. Despite this, the presence of customer help points ensures that assistance is always nearby, even at an unstaffed station.

Exmouth Train Station is designed to ensure a smooth experience for travelers, providing a range of amenities for convenience and support. The ticket office operates from 07:10 to 15:25 on weekdays and Saturdays, making ticket purchases and collections straightforward, even though there are no opening hours specified for Sundays. For those who prefer digital solutions, ticket machines are available and accessible, supporting online collection and smartcard issuances.
Accessibility is a priority, with step-free access across the station, ensuring easy movement for all passengers. An induction loop is present for hearing assistance, and help points are situated for immediate assistance. However, please note that there are no waiting rooms, nor is there luggage storage available. CCTV is installed to uphold safety and security around the clock.
Journeying from or to Exmouth Train Station is as scenic as it gets. With convenient transport links, travelers can effortlessly continue their adventures beyond the train. Taxis are readily accessible at the station, ensuring easy transfers to local destinations, and the rail replacement services are located at the station car park for those times maintenance is essential. For the eco-conscious traveler, cycle hire is available, including the popular Brompton Bike hire from self-service machines.
